Cruise sector: Singapore accounts for nearly half of Southeast Asia's passenger visits in 2024
Longer, more diversified cruise itineraries and stronger partnerships with regional ports - these are among plans by the Singapore Tourism Board to further develop a vibrant cruise landscape. This is as it draws on findings from its latest report with a global cruise association. The report found that Singapore’s cruise industry accounted for nearly half of Southeast Asia’s 3.9 million passenger visits in 2024. Claudia Lim with more.
